Where the money goes in West Valley City
A typical $9,400 West Valley City project, broken down by line item.
- Equipment50% · $4,700
- Labor & installation30% · $2,820
- Ductwork & line set13% · $1,222
- Permit, startup & disposal7% · $658

Ways to save in West Valley City
- Replace in spring or fall — mid-summer emergency swaps carry a 10–20% premium.
- Claim the 25C federal tax credit: up to $2,000 for a qualifying heat pump, $600 for AC or furnace.
- Check your utility's rebate portal; many add $500–$1,500 on high-efficiency equipment.
- Right-size with a Manual J load calculation — oversized systems cost more and short-cycle.
- Don't over-buy SEER in mild climates; the payback can exceed the equipment's life.
